## Release Checklist — Item 7: Sort Stability in Gribble Reports

Quick one for review: confirm the Gribble report builder keeps stable ordering when two rows tie on the sort column. We switched the comparator last sprint and a flaky snapshot test suggests ties now shuffle between runs. Please eyeball the comparator change and rerun the snapshot suite three times. If ordering holds, check this item off. Verify against the candidate build whose token appears below.

pipeline stamp: htk4_ae36

Build provenance — Consent banner rollout (Tindervale web). Quick note for whoever inherits this: the banner ships from the shared assets pipeline, not the main app repo, so version bumps there won't show here. Region-gating config lives in the rollout manifest. The artifact currently serving production is identified just below.

pipeline stamp: htk9_ce63042d9

Management Meeting Minutes — Second-Source Supplier Search

Attendees: Marla, Deevan, Ros (chair)

Ros opened with the usual reminder that our reliance on a single gasket supplier for the Tindrel line keeps everyone up at night. Deevan has shortlisted three candidate firms and will run sample audits next month. Marla flagged that switching costs need a finance model before we commit — action on her team. Budget envelope to be confirmed at the next session. The broader plan behind this search is set out below.

board note of fahif-yahog: Gross margin on Wenath came in at 10 percent against a plan of 5 percent. Only 3 of the 100 pilot accounts renewed Wenath, so a churn review is set for July 15.

## Runbook: string extraction

Run `extract_strings.sh` from the Lingotide repo root. The script pushes extracted translation strings to the internal Phrasevault service. It fails fast on auth errors; do not retry more than twice. Export the service credential before running. The current key appears below.

app token of badug-tahaf = qvz11-nP5FBNr8qnh